Conditional Perfect / Conditionnel passé of the French verb attribuer
The Conditional Perfect / Conditionnel passé tense conjugations for the French verb attribuer, along with their English translations.Verb phrases
Conditional Perfect / Conditionnel passé The French Conditional Perfect (the past conditional) or Conditionnel passé is made with the conditional tense of avoir or être and the past participle of the verb. The past participle agrees with the subject for verbs that take être, or with the direct object for verbs that take avoir. | Scored | |

j'aurais attribué | I would have attributed | |
tu aurais attribué | you would have attributed | |
il aurait attribué | he would have attributed | |
elle aurait attribué | she would have attributed | |
nous aurions attribué | we would have attributed | |
vous auriez attribué | you would have attributed | |
ils auraient attribué | they would have attributed | |
elles auraient attribué | they would have attributed |
